Duck Breast with Fig and Cider Glaze
Fresh figs and cider combine to make this glaze - great with grilled duck breast

Ingredients
2 Luv-a-Duck, Duck Breasts
100ml fig and cider glaze
100ml dry cider
salt and pepper
Method
- Heat oven to 190c.
- Score the skin and season with salt and pepper.
- Heat a pan until you can feel moderate heat coming off it. Place the duck, skin side down into the pan for 5 minutes until golden. Turn the duck breast over and cook for 2 minutes. Place the duck in a roasting tray and cook in the oven for 8 minutes. Remove the duck and let this rest for at leaast 5 minutes before slicing into it.
- Taking care with hot pan, skim off as much duck fat as possible, add cider and bring back to boil.
- Reduce by half, add fig and cider glaze and heat through – do not boil.
Chef’s tips
Slice duck breast on the diagonal and serve with sauce.
Serve on a bed of lentils.
